CVE-2016-8954 1 Ibm 1 Dashdb Local 2026-06-17 7.5 HIGH 9.8 CRITICAL
IBM dashDB Local uses hard-coded credentials that could allow a remote attacker to gain access to the Docker container or database.
CVE-2016-8754 1 Huawei 2 Oceanstor 5600 V3, Oceanstor 5600 V3 Firmware 2026-06-17 5.4 MEDIUM 7.5 HIGH
Huawei OceanStor 5600 V3 V300R003C00 has a hardcoded SSH key vulnerability; the hardcoded keys are used to encrypt communication data and authenticate different nodes of the devices. An attacker may obtain the hardcoded keys and log in to such a device through SSH.
CVE-2016-8731 1 Foscam 2 C1 Webcam, C1 Webcam Firmware 2026-06-17 7.5 HIGH 9.8 CRITICAL
Hard-coded FTP credentials (r:r) are included in the Foscam C1 running firmware 1.9.1.12. Knowledge of these credentials would allow remote access to any cameras found on the internet that do not have port 50021 blocked by an intermediate device.
CVE-2016-8717 1 Moxa 2 Awk-3131a, Awk-3131a Firmware 2026-06-17 10.0 HIGH 9.8 CRITICAL
An exploitable Use of Hard-coded Credentials vulnerability exists in the Moxa AWK-3131A Wireless Access Point running firmware 1.1. The device operating system contains an undocumented, privileged (root) account with hard-coded credentials, giving attackers full control of affected devices.
CVE-2016-8567 1 Siemens 1 Sicam Pas\/pqs 2026-06-17 7.5 HIGH 9.8 CRITICAL
An issue was discovered in Siemens SICAM PAS before 8.00. A factory account with hard-coded passwords is present in the SICAM PAS installations. Attackers might gain privileged access to the database over Port 2638/TCP.
CVE-2016-8491 1 Fortinet 1 Fortiwlc 2026-06-17 9.4 HIGH 9.1 CRITICAL
The presence of a hardcoded account named 'core' in Fortinet FortiWLC allows attackers to gain unauthorized read/write access via a remote shell.
CVE-2016-8361 1 Lynxspring 1 Jenesys Bas Bridge 2026-06-17 7.5 HIGH 8.6 HIGH
An issue was discovered in Lynxspring JENEsys BAS Bridge versions 1.1.8 and older. The application uses a hard-coded username with no password allowing an attacker into the system without authentication.
CVE-2016-7560 1 Fortinet 1 Fortiwlc 2026-06-17 10.0 HIGH 9.8 CRITICAL
The rsyncd server in Fortinet FortiWLC 6.1-2-29 and earlier, 7.0-9-1, 7.0-10-0, 8.0-5-0, 8.1-2-0, and 8.2-4-0 has a hardcoded rsync account, which allows remote attackers to read or write to arbitrary files via unspecified vectors.
CVE-2016-6829 2 Barclamp-trove Project, Crowbar-openstack Project 2 Barclamp-trove, Crowbar-openstack 2026-06-17 7.5 HIGH 9.8 CRITICAL
The trove service user in (1) Openstack deployment (aka crowbar-openstack) and (2) Trove Barclamp (aka barclamp-trove and crowbar-barclamp-trove) in the Crowbar Framework has a default password, which makes it easier for remote attackers to obtain access via unspecified vectors.
CVE-2016-6535 1 Aver 2 Eh6108h\+, Eh6108h\+ Firmware 2026-06-17 10.0 HIGH 9.8 CRITICAL
AVer Information EH6108H+ devices with firmware X9.03.24.00.07l have hardcoded accounts, which allows remote attackers to obtain root access by leveraging knowledge of the credentials and establishing a TELNET session.
CVE-2016-6532 1 Dexis 1 Imaging Suite 2026-06-17 10.0 HIGH 9.8 CRITICAL
DEXIS Imaging Suite 10 has a hardcoded password for the sa account, which allows remote attackers to obtain administrative access by entering this password in a DEXIS_DATA SQL Server session.
CVE-2016-6530 1 Dentsply Sirona 1 Cdr Dicom 2026-06-17 10.0 HIGH 9.8 CRITICAL
Dentsply Sirona (formerly Schick) CDR Dicom 5 and earlier has default passwords for the sa and cdr accounts, which allows remote attackers to obtain administrative access by leveraging knowledge of these passwords.
CVE-2016-5818 1 Schneider-electric 2 Powerlogic Pm8ecc, Powerlogic Pm8ecc Firmware 2026-06-17 7.5 HIGH 9.8 CRITICAL
An issue was discovered in Schneider Electric PowerLogic PM8ECC device 2.651 and older. Undocumented hard-coded credentials allow access to the device.
CVE-2016-5816 1 Westermo 8 Mrd-305-din, Mrd-305-din Firmware, Mrd-315-din and 5 more 2026-06-17 5.0 MEDIUM 7.5 HIGH
A Use of Hard-Coded Cryptographic Key issue was discovered in MRD-305-DIN versions older than 1.7.5.0, and MRD-315, MRD-355, MRD-455 versions older than 1.7.5.0. The device utilizes hard-coded private cryptographic keys that may allow an attacker to decrypt traffic from any other source.
CVE-2016-5678 1 Nuuo 2 Nvrmini 2, Nvrsolo 2026-06-17 10.0 HIGH 9.8 CRITICAL
NUUO NVRmini 2 1.0.0 through 3.0.0 and NUUO NVRsolo 1.0.0 through 3.0.0 have hardcoded root credentials, which allows remote attackers to obtain administrative access via unspecified vectors.
CVE-2016-5645 1 Rockwellautomation 6 1766-l32awa, 1766-l32awaa, 1766-l32bwa and 3 more 2026-06-17 7.5 HIGH 7.3 HIGH
Rockwell Automation MicroLogix 1400 PLC 1766-L32BWA, 1766-L32AWA, 1766-L32BXB, 1766-L32BWAA, 1766-L32AWAA, and 1766-L32BXBA devices have a hardcoded SNMP community, which makes it easier for remote attackers to load arbitrary firmware updates by leveraging knowledge of this community.
CVE-2016-5333 1 Vmware 1 Photon Os 2026-06-17 9.3 HIGH 9.8 CRITICAL
VMware Photos OS OVA 1.0 before 2016-08-14 has a default SSH public key in an authorized_keys file, which allows remote attackers to obtain SSH access by leveraging knowledge of the private key.
CVE-2016-5081 1 Zmodo 2 Zp-ibh-13w, Zp-ne-14-s 2026-06-17 10.0 HIGH 9.8 CRITICAL
ZModo ZP-NE14-S and ZP-IBH-13W devices have a hardcoded root password, which makes it easier for remote attackers to obtain access via a TELNET session.
CVE-2016-3953 1 Web2py 1 Web2py 2026-06-17 7.5 HIGH 9.8 CRITICAL
The sample web application in web2py before 2.14.2 might allow remote attackers to execute arbitrary code via vectors involving use of a hardcoded encryption key when calling the session.connect function.
CVE-2016-3685 3 Apple, Microsoft, Sap 3 Macos, Windows, Download Manager 2026-06-17 1.9 LOW 4.7 MEDIUM
SAP Download Manager 2.1.142 and earlier generates an encryption key from a small key space on Windows and Mac systems, which allows context-dependent attackers to obtain sensitive configuration information by leveraging knowledge of a hardcoded key in the program code and a computer BIOS serial number, aka SAP Security Note 2282338.
